Starfield's Apex Parrothawks Are Basically Morrowind's Infamous Cliff Racers

Morrowindhas flying enemies called cliff racers that hunt in packs and strike down at you like drones. There are so many of them that Bethesda wrote a meta-joke into the lore forOblivionthat Jiub had been sainted fordriving them to extinction.Well, Nirn is only one planet. Starfield has 1,000… and they’re back. Cliff racers were infamous mostly because they were a pain in the neck to kill. Even with magic and ranged weapons, they hovered so far overhead and only occasionally dipped down to attack, often dealing huge damage while stunning you....

The Best Hero Cards In Hearthstone

Hearthstone’s Spells and Minions come with a wide variety of unique effects, but few among them can match the game-warping impact of the Hero Cards. These cards replace your Hero with a new one, changingyour Hero Powerand often coming witha powerful Battlecryas well. Related:Hearthstone: Best Taunt Cards, Ranked As a result, they can completely change the way a class plays. Unsurprisingly, such game-warping cards have seen quite a few nerfs and buffs across Hearthstone’s history....
